In any given neighborhood or municipality, it's quite likely that individuals who hold certain roles, such as elected officials, are de facto community leaders.To address this problem, citizens and local leaders must be involved in the planning stages before disaster strikes. Local leaders should seek to serve two important functions: 1) a bridge between citizens, government officials, and crisis managers, and 2) a moderator for community discussions on issues of preparedness.

Maria Eitel, Founder and Chair of the Nike ...Community Leaders may not see your messages to their Community Number(s) until you fully complete the registration process and connect with them; Community may filter messages from reaching a Community Leader for various reasons, including based on a Community Leader’s settings and where such messages violate our Acceptable Use Policy;Apr 4, 2021 · Here you can see ten qualities that make for a great community leader. 1. Self Awareness. A first and foremost quality that makes for a great quality community leader is that they are self aware. They understand that before they can lead others, they must know about their own abilities first.

This article presents a literature review of the relationship between leadership and community participation to identify the research topics underpinning the studies and theoretical ...Participate in or help organize a community parade. Clean up vacant lot. Produce a neighborhood newspaper. Campaign for more lighting along poorly lit streets. Create a newcomers group in your neighborhood to help welcome new families. Petition your town leaders to build more drinking fountains and public restrooms. Keith Peterson Jun 07, 2022 8.2K 229.7K Views Community leaders come in a variety of personalities and styles. The primary goals of transformational leadership are to inspire growth, promote loyalty, and instill confidence in group members.Community leadership is a specific form of the general concept of leadership. It is frequently based in place and so is local, although it can also represent a community of common interest, purpose or practice. It can be individual or group leadership, voluntary or paid. In many localities it is provided by a combination of local volunteers ... ]
